WARNING:
The surfaces of the dry pump, booster (if fitted) and spools are very hot when the dry
pumping system is running. Allow these surfaces to cool to safe temperatures before
installing the accessories inside the enclosure. Be sure to route and secure accessory
cables as shown in their installation manuals to prevent the cables from resting on
hot surfaces.
Refer to the individual accessories manuals for installation information.

5.12 Commission the dry pumping system

WARNING:
During some application cycles, the dry pumping system may exceed the OSHA
1910.95 Occupational Noise Exposure Limits, the EU noise directive 2003/10/EC or
other regional noise limits dependent upon the process, duty cycle, installation or
environment in which the dry pumping system is being operated. A sound pressure
survey must be conducted after installation. If necessary, the controls must be
implemented to ensure that the relevant limits are not exceeded during the
operation and that adequate precautions are taken to prevent the person from
exposure to the high noise levels during the operation.
1.
Before starting the pump, the main power supply should be connected correctly
and cooling water and purge gas need to be checked.
2.
Switch on the cooling water and purge gas supplies.
3.
Ensure that the exhaust extraction system is not blocked (for example, that valves
in the exhaust extraction system are open).
4.
Ensure that all openings to atmospheric pressure in the foreline vacuum system
are closed.
5.
Either connect the main power supply or install the run button (1x6:6 and 1x6:7).
6.
If the dry pumping system starts and continues to operate, continue at step 8. If a
warning or alarm condition is indicated:
7.
Look at the pressure gauge in the inlet pipeline:
8.
Visually check the purge gas dial pressure gauge on the rear of the pump to ensure
that the purge gas is being delivered to the pump. Continue to check the dial
pressure gauge regularly as the dry pumping system is used.
9.
After the dry pumping system is commissioned:
